Summary:This dataset provides model output for 20th and 21st-century ice-ocean simulations in the Amundsen Sea. The simulations are performed with the MITgcm model at 1/10 degree resolution, including components for the ocean, sea ice, and ice shelf thermodynamics. Atmospheric forcing is provided by the CESM1 climate model for the historical period (1920-2005) and four future scenarios (2006-2100), using 5-10 ensemble members each. The open ocean boundaries are forced by either the corresponding CESM1 simulation or a present-day climatology. The simulations were completed in 2022 by Kaitlin Naughten at the British Antarctic Survey (Polar Oceans team). UKRI Fund for International Collaboration NE/S011994/1 ... : Simulations were performed with the Massachusetts Institute of Technology general circulation model (MITgcm) version 67s, over the Amundsen Sea region (140 degrees W:80 degrees W, 76 degrees S:62 degrees S). Resolution is 1/10 degrees in the horizontal, with 50 levels in the vertical. Bathymetry and ice shelf topography were generated using BedMachine version 2. Atmospheric forcing is given by the CESM1 Large Ensemble (1920-2005 historical, 2006-2100 RCP 8.5, first 10 members), the CESM1 Medium Ensemble (2006-2080 RCP 4.5, first 10 members), the CESM1 Low Warming 2C Ensemble (2006-2100, first 10 members), and the CESM1 Low Warming 1.5C Ensemble (2006-2100, first 5 members). Lateral boundary conditions were derived from the corresponding CESM1 ensembles, except for the ''Fixed BC'' experiments which used the World Ocean Atlas 2018 for temperature and salinity, and the Biogeochemical Southern Ocean State Estimate iteration 122 for all other variables.
